Handover note — Skylark canary gating

Hi, taking over from Priya on the Glintfall deploy system. Quick note for plugin authors: your canary won't promote until the gating rules pass — error rate under threshold for two windows, plus the synthetic checks green. Don't try to bypass the gate in your plugin manifest; the promoter will reject it. If you ever need to restore a plugin signing account after lockout, the recovery tool will ask for the passphrase below.

unlock words, tawif-tahop: oliys-ulawyn-tamdor-lamys-casox-jormir-fraius-kasath-ulador-ulamir-holir-sorys-holeth

Handover Note — Warranty Overrun, Dursten Line

Tomas: warranty costs on the Dursten compressor line ran 22% over budget this quarter. Root cause is the seal batch from Kelvane Supply; claims still arriving. I've frozen goodwill replacements pending review. Branch managers should log all claims centrally, no exceptions. Escalate anything above standard limits to me. One item stays close-hold.

board note of tadup-tajog: Headcount on the Oliiel team goes from 31 to 88 by the end of February. Gross margin on Oliiel came in at 62 percent against a plan of 29 percent.

Subject: Veltrix Line Pricing — Decision Needed

Team,

Welcoming our incoming director, Mara Quillen, to this thread. The Veltrix Pro tier is underpriced against the Corvant suite by roughly 12%. Proposal: raise list price next quarter, grandfather current accounts for six months. Objections by Friday. Mara will own rollout. Details on the broader plan follow below.

confidential, kagup-bafog: Fraaxax Group is in early talks to buy Soroxox Group for about $343.8 million. The Olidor launch date is June 14, and nothing goes to the press before then. Legal wants the Aldmirek Logistics term sheet signed before July 23.